As the much-anticipated Champions Cup showdown between Barcelona legends and African legendary stars slated for this weekend at Moshood Abiola National Stadium in Abuja approaches, the Senegalese legendary midfielder Khalilou Fadiga, and Nigerian music sensation Odumodublvck have their confirmed their availability for the match.
The duo will be part of an array of sporting and entertainment stars converging in Abuja for a one-of-a-kind football spectacle celebrating talent, unity, and African excellence.
Khalilou Fadiga, renowned for his dazzling performances with the Senegalese national team and clubs such as Inter Milan and Bolton Wanderers, expressed excitement about returning to Nigeria for the event.
He earned 37 caps for the Senegal national team. He was part of the Senegal team that defeated reigning champions France in the opening fixture of the 2002 World Cup and made it to the quarter-finals. He was also part of the team that finished runner-up in the 2002 African Cup of Nations.

The Barça Legends squad features global greats Ronaldinho, Ludovic Giuly, Javier Saviola, Jesús Angoy, Samuel Okunowo, Marc Valiente, and Fernando Navarro. They will go head-to-head against the African Legends, led by Jay-Jay Okocha, Nwankwo Kanu, Alex Song, Mark Fish, and other revered figures of African football.
Beyond the match, the event offers fans a total experience, from a ‘Legends Meet & Greet’ to an exclusive gala dinner, where supporters and guests will have the rare opportunity to engage directly with football’s finest in an atmosphere of celebration and camaraderie. Proceeds from the day will directly support initiatives focused on the girl child across Africa.
The event is organised by the Attom Foundation in collaboration with ZMB Homes and WGI.
